    losing fuel pressure

    I've got a 98 z28, when I shut the engine off the fuel pressure bleeds off at the fuel pump, considering what a pain that would be to change, I was wondering if anybody knows of some sort of check valve that could be placed inline around the fuel filter? Seems like that would be a lot cheaper & easier.........

    I took it to the dealer, they say it went from 60 psi to 0 in 10 seconds - my feeling is that it doesn't always do that, usually starts right up first thing in the morning, most of the problem is when it's hot outside....doesn't seem to have the problem as much now that we are past summer temps. BTW, they ONLY want $1100 to replace the pump

    So after their diagnostics they're condemning the pump? $1100...ouch. There's a link here on replacing it by cutting an access panel on the rear deck - maybe you can get the pump cheaper (gmpartsdirect) and have a shop do the panel a lot cheaper. I'll find the link.
